Been a while since I started a new build, plan to build this one almost OOB.
IMG_6411.jpeg
IMG_6411.jpeg (521.49 KiB) Viewed 5734 times
Comes with working tracks and metal volute springs. From what I have read the tracks are a fiddle to put together and the detail on the commanders M2 is a bit soft, but we shall see!

Built up the six bogies. The steel springs are nice, the suspension is workable but a bit of a fiddle to put together. Pay attention to the instructions, the suspension arms can be installed the wrong way round.

Tracks done. Was a labour of love and very tedious but they do build up nice. The pads are two pieces, the end connectors x2 and the duckbills if you want them. All held together with flimsy wire. My tips;
- you need 75 links per side, not the 79 the instructions call for
- cut the wire to 12mm lengths. This is enough to work with and means you won’t run out.
- use the assembly jig, insert the wire from one side, sit flush and glue with a dab of CA. Cut then file flush on the other side, then another dab of CA.
- some links may need a micro drill to open up as there is flash over the holes on some end connectors and some of the pads also get clogged.
